Cheaper, easier access to fruits and veggies key to college students eating better

(American Osteopathic Association) A benefit-oriented approach to nutrition increases college students' willingness to consume fruits and vegetables, yet the availability and cost of healthy food on campus are critical to changing their eating habits, according to research published in The Journal of the American Osteopathic Association.
